IDEALFORCE logo

Software Developer - C#/.NET/WPF(701001)

IDEALFORCE
Full-time
On-site
Dallas, Texas, United States
Software Development

Company Description

IDEALFORCE has multiple FULL TIME positions available immediately for Sr Front end Developers to join our customer in Dallas, TX. Please find below additional details about this job. Kindly respond with your most up to date resume if you would like to pursue this opportunity. Client prefers LOCAL CANDIDATES for this role as it requires in person interview. Client will provide H1b Sponsorship if required. 


Our Client is a provider of order and investment management platform technology solutions to alternative and traditional asset management clients. Our Client provides global clients with scalable solutions to create and capture business opportunities using a proven technology approach that drives efficiency and allows fund managers and traders to focus on investment performance. Our Client offers multi-asset, multi-currency order, portfolio, and risk management capabilities that it believes delivers the most streamlined, powerful, intuitive and innovative work flow solutions in the market today.  


The GUI Software Developerwill work closely with members of account management and other groups of the Client to develop best in class desktop trading applications. This individual is expected to provide technical expertise to support, enhance, and refresh existing and new trading desktop applications. Must demonstrate ability to analyze complex business and technical problems and make sound technical decisions proactively and in a self-directed manner. The role will utilize C#/.Net, object-oriented analysis, design, and programming to develop robust, flexible software solutions. Focus will be on developing reusable high performance trading GUI applications in a fast-paced and business-focused environment.​

Job Description

-Design, develop and deploy new and existing trading applications using C# and various .NET technologies. 

-Continuously improve performance, functionality, and stability of the system by refactoring and customization.

-Guide and implement firm and industry architectural standards. 

-Collaborate with account management to understand business requirements and provide solutions.

-Work closely with support and implementations teams to provide day-to-day support for trading applications.

-Build, package and deploy various trading applications to different clients 

Qualifications

-Expert-level C# and the .Net framework technologies

-Experience in GUI development using WPF and MVP/MVVM patterns

-Strong Object Oriented Analysis and Design concepts

Experience in using various Design Pattern.

Experience in designing and developing high-performance multithreaded applications 

Solid understanding of the Windows API and UI subsystems.

Strong written and verbal communication skills. 


Desirable:

-Experience developing financial applications in Trading Systems

-Experience with Dev Express or Infragistics type of GUI controls package

-Knowledge in any scripting languages and SQL.

Familiarity with Web Services development using WCF

Messaging (TIBCO, MQ, or similar)

Agile software development processes such as Automated Unit Testing, Continuous integration etc

Working knowledge in C++ is a plus


Interpersonal Skills:

Highly motivated and delivery oriented

Passion for solving investment business problems through the use of technology.

Strong critical reasoning skills.

Detail-oriented approach to solving problems.

Strong work ethic & high degree of integrity.

Self-starter and able to work with minimal supervision.

Team player, willing to help teammates achieve their goals and work in a collaborative environment. 


Education:

• Bachelor degree in Computer Science, Electrical Engineering, or equivalent.


Summary

The successful candidate will be a self-starter who has demonstrated the ability to function independently in a fast-paced, dynamic, and demanding trading environment. This person will be intellectually curious, intuitive, rigorous, trust worthy and have the highest ethical standards. In addition, (s)he will be affective addressing a number of internal and external audiences in a professional manner. This person will add value by working on a number of simultaneous projects with minimal supervision and exemplary follow-through. ​


Benefits Overview:

-Medical and dental plans

-Retirement savings plan

-Vacation and sick time

-Short and long-term disability coverage

-Wellness initiatives

-Travel insurance

-Educational reimbursement

-Transit benefits

-Onsite professional development

-Teladoc coverage

-Access to fitness facilities

-Backup child care

-Employee Assistance Program

-Life Insurance

-Flexible spending accounts


Additional Information

- "All your information will be kept confidential according to EEO guidelines". - All candidates who are authorized to work in US are encouraged to apply. - Candidates must clear the Background check prior to commencing the assignment. 


THIRD PARTY CANDIDATES:

Email your candidate/s resume to pete dot tylor at idealforce.com along with the following details: Rate, Current location and Availability.


Disclaimer :

 The above statements are intended to describe the general nature and level of work being performed by people assigned to this classification. They are not to be construed as an exhaustive list of all responsibilities, duties, and skills required of personnel so classified. All personnel may be required to perform duties outside of their normal responsibilities from time to time, as needed.